    Baylor College of Medicine (BCM) in Houston, Texas, is a highly respected, high-ranking medical school that offers comprehensive, quality medical education programs. BCM has a medical school that educates future physicians. They also house an allied health division, which provides training in: * Nurse anesthesia * Physician assisting * Prosthetics and orthotics BCM's medical education programs give students the chance to work in one of more than eight teaching hospitals. Medical students also begin working with patients as soon as a few weeks into their program. Baylor College of Medicine also has a graduate research division, which was ranked as one of the top in the United States by U.S. News and World Report. Graduates of BCM are proof of its excellence. They have consistently developed strong careers as practicing doctors, medical school chairs, medical researchers and executives of pharmaceutical companies. BCM also has an innovative program for exceptional high school students who wish to enter the eight-year medical school program. Admissions requirements are different for each program. Admission to most programs is in three phases, with the applicant-pool narrowed down over the course of each phase. Admissions requirements generally include test scores, GPA and courses taken. Financial aid is available through federal grants and loans. Students are also encouraged to seek out scholarships, grants and loans from medical and healthcare agencies and organizations.

    PopMatters is an international magazine of cultural criticism and analysis. It offers reviews, interviews, and essays on cultural products and expressions in areas such as music, television, films, books, video games, sports, theatres, the visual arts, travel, and the internet. PopMatters has been providing smart readers with sharp, entertaining writing on a wide range of topics in pop culture offering a refuge from the usual hype and gossip. Many of its writers are called upon for their opinions by notable members of the media such as the BBC , NPR , MSNBC , Radio Australia, and VH1 . Publications such as USA Today.com, Alternet.org, and Imdb.com regularly pick up links to PopMatters articles and post quotes from PopMatters writers. PopMatters was launched in 1999 in Chicago, Illinois.
